pulp

IoT edge platform

A platform for designing and implementing ultra-low-power, parallel computing systems for IoT edge applications.

This is the top-level project for the PULP Platform. It instantiates a PULP open-source system with a PULP SoC (microcontroller) domain accelerated by a PULP cluster with 8 cores.

GitHub

458 stars
33 watching
116 forks
Language: SystemVerilog
last commit: about 2 months ago
Linked from 1 awesome list


Backlinks from these awesome lists:

Related projects:

Repository Description Stars
pulp-platform/pulpissimo A platform for designing and implementing ultra-low-power microcontrollers with advanced features like autonomous I/O, HWPEs, and simple interrupt controllers. 392
pulp-platform/pulpino An open-source microcontroller system based on RISC-V, designed for ultra-low-power signal processing applications. 907
pulp-platform/hero An FPGA-based research platform for exploring heterogeneous computers with accelerators and host CPUs. 95
macchina-io/macchina.io An IoT edge computing platform that enables rapid deployment of device applications with secure, modular, and extensible C++ and JavaScript environments. 517
dt42/berrynet An edge computing platform that enables AIoT applications on devices such as Raspberry Pi without internet connectivity. 1,604
iotsharp/iotsharp An open-source IoT platform for data collection, processing, visualization, and device management using C# 1,060
pulp-platform/axi Provides reusable IP modules and verification infrastructure for designing high-performance on-chip communication networks adhering to AXI standards. 1,134
pulp-platform/common_cells A collection of reusable Verilog systemVerilog modules used to synchronize clocks and handles asynchronous crossings in digital circuits 531
sitewhere/sitewhere A platform for managing and integrating data from Internet of Things devices at scale 1,020
astarte-platform/astarte An IoT data management and processing platform built on top of Elixir and open-source projects like RabbitMQ and Cassandra/ScyllaDB. 242
pulp-platform/idma A modular data movement accelerator designed to support various platforms and protocols 102
lf-edge/ekuiper A lightweight IoT data analytics and stream processing engine designed for edge devices. 1,505
edgenesis/shifu Enables IoT devices to be integrated into a Kubernetes cluster without requiring separate infrastructure management 1,291
united-manufacturing-hub/united-manufacturing-hub A toolkit for building an Industrial IoT platform with real-time data processing and visualization capabilities. 285
mathcoll/t6 A data-first IoT platform to connect physical objects with time-series databases and perform data analysis. 34